WebJul 27, 2024 · Monitoring recommendations include checking alanine aminotransferase (ALT) and HBV DNA level at baseline prior to or at the beginning of their anticancer … WebImmune-tolerant chronic hepatitis B virus (HBV) infection (hepatitis B e antigen [HBeAg]-positive, high HBV DNA, and persistently normal alanine aminotransferase [ALT] level): monitor ALT every 3-6 months. Monitor more frequently, along with HBV DNA levels, if ALT level becomes elevated. Check HBeAg status every 6-12 months. WebOct 29, 2024 · Hepatitis B virus (HBV) is an enveloped, partially double-stranded DNA virus that is transmitted via infected blood and bodily fluids. [] Infection with the hepatitis B virus causes hepatocellular necrosis and … WebJun 10, 2024 · Individuals with a chronic infection may have persistent HBeAg, with continued circulation of HBsAg (and HBV DNA), with IgG but not IgM anti-HBc, without anti-HBs. Detection of HBsAg for longer than six months after acute infection is diagnostic of chronic infection.
